The industrial automation landscape is dominated by a select group of giants, each with a rich history and a broad portfolio of cutting-edge solutions. Among these standouts are Siemens, Allen-Bradley, ABB, and Schneider Electric.
Siemens, a global engineering giant, is renowned for its comprehensive range of automation products, from programmable logic controllers (PLCs) to industrial robots and systems. Allen-Bradley, a Rockwell Automation company, holds a strong standing in the market with its rugged and reliable PLCs, HMIs, and motion control solutions.
ABB, a Swiss-Swedish multinational, is a leading provider sick of electrification technologies, particularly known for its advanced robotics systems used in manufacturing and other industries. Schneider Electric, a French company, focuses on electrical distribution, automation, and energy management solutions, providing a complete suite of products for industrial applications.
